Trump praises military and 'angel' moms at White House Mother's Day lunch
Melania Trump praised military families and the president later tied the tribute to immigration, drug and family policy while honoring mothers who lost children.
- President Donald Trump hosted Angel Moms and Gold Star Mothers at a White House Rose Garden luncheon on Friday, May 08, 2026, honoring mothers who lost children to military service or immigrant-related crimes.
- Honoring Gold Star families, Trump recognized Janice Chance, whose son, Marine Capt. Jesse Melton, died in Afghanistan, and the 13 service members killed in the 2021 Abbey Gate attack.
- Criticizing past border policies, Trump labeled them "stupid borders" created by "stupid people," while claiming his administration successfully established "The strongest border in American history."
- Closing the luncheon, Trump called motherhood "the most important job there is," praising the women as "strong and truly heroic moms" for their resilience in the face of profound loss.

Trump Honors Gold Star, Angel Moms in Rose Garden Ahead of Mother's Day
President Donald Trump delivered remarks to Gold Star Moms, who lost a child to active service in the U.S. military, and Angel Moms, who lost children at the hands of illegal immigration, in the Rose Garden on Friday.
